Metadata import that uses Snowflake 3.12.15 JDBC driver fails when driver folder includes Amazon Athena JDBC driver

Troubleshooting


Problem

Importing metadata that uses Snowflake 3.12.15 JDBC driver fails when the drivers folder also includes the Athena JDBC driver. The same issue does not occur with older versions of the Snowflake JDBC driver.

Symptom

The metadata import does not complete.
 

Cause

The drivers folder in Cognos Analytics includes a copy of the Amazon Athena JDBC driver and Snowflake 3.12.15 JDBC driver.  An import references objects in the Snowflake database, that have an underscore character in their name.

Reference # SNOW-259063
 

Diagnosing The Problem

Test a connection defined in Cognos Analytics that refers to a Snowflake server. When the test completes, click the feedback which displays the version of the Snowflake JDBC driver.

Confirm if the drivers folder in Cognos Analytics also includes a copy of the Amazon Athena JDBC driver.
 

Resolving The Problem

Upgrade to Snowflake JDBC v3.13.2.
